This position will be remote and will require Saturdays and evening shifts.

Responsibilities

  • Manage inbound and outbound calls, and emails from customers.
  • Assist with enrolling Precheck customers
  • Provide assistance and guidance to our partners/customers on how to use our application.
  • Opening trouble tickets, assisting customers/partners and resolving problems in a professional and timely manner and escalate to other team members as needed.
  • Document, track, monitor and follow up on problems/inquiries to ensure resolution in a timely manner.
  • Troubleshoot, diagnose and repair desktop hardware and software problems.
  • Support Windows-based workstations.
  • Install and maintain tablets, photo devices, finger print and document scanners.
  • Provide level two diagnostic support over the phone and via remote connections.
  • Provide level one network troubleshooting for physical and logical connectivity issues.
  • Work cooperatively with other Telos Corporation and industry partners.

Qualifications

  • High School diploma.
  • Must be able to obtain the required security clearance for this position.
  • 1+ years of experience with Microsoft Office programs (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and Outlook) is required.
  • Experience with PCs, laptops, printers, mobile devices, digital scanners, and copiers is preferred.
  • Experience with customer service is preferred.
  • A professional attitude regarding attention to detail and customer service with excellent organizational skills.
  • Effective communication skills and the ability to interact professionally with a diverse group of clients and staff.
  • Must be a team player and be able to work simultaneously with team members.
